Russian President Vladimir Putin announced Tuesday in statements to the Russian public television journalist Rossiya-1, Pável Zarubin, that his Ukrainian counterpart, Volodimir Zelenski, lacks legitimacy by not having undergone elections after expiring his current mandate. To the point … That, for that reason, with him he does not plan to sign any peace agreement, despite ensuring that he is open to such possibility.
“You can negotiate with whoever-in Ukraine-, but due to his lack of legitimacy he (Zelenski) has no right to sign anything,” Putin warned. In his words, «if we start conversations now, they will be illegitimate. There is a problem here: when the current head of the regime- in Ukraine- signed the decree prohibiting negotiating with Russia, was a legitimate president, but not now, so he cannot cancel the decree ».
In the opinion of the Kremlin chief, the one who could annul the decree, according to the Ukrainian Constitution, would be the president of the Rada, the Ukrainian Parliament. «If there were will, it would be possible to solve any legal issue. But for now we simply do not see such desire, ”added the top Russian leader, who for his part claimed to be willing to” select “the group of Russian negotiators and allow Zelenski to participate in the conversations, but not to subscribe anything.
Putin believes that Ukrainian legislation forces to comply with electoral deadlines, even in war. He also referred to attempts to stop the conflict shortly, in March 2022, noting that “our negotiations began immediately after the start of the special military operation. At first we told the then Ukrainian leaders: the people of the Popular Republic of Lugansk and the People’s Republic of Donetsk do not want to be part of Ukraine. Get out of there and that’s it, everything would end without military and war actions ».
However, Putin continued, “we received kyiv signs that they would fight to the last Ukrainian (…) West convinced Ukraine to continue war.” “But they would not have lasted much without money and ammunition-envied by the West-, everything would have ended in a month and a half or two months, in this sense Ukrainian sovereignty is almost nil,” he said. The Russian president also said that the withdrawal of the troops in the kyiv surroundings, in March 2022, “was made at the request of some European leaders (…) who denounced that Ukraine cannot sign a peace treaty with a gun pointing to the head ». He regretted that, after ordering the exit of his troops from the suburbs of the Ukrainian capital, “we were once again deceived.”
